引言:在 TPWallet 生态中,“能量”是支撑链上交互、合约执行与支付能力的关键抽象。本文从便捷资产存取、合约开发、专业视角报告、智能化支付解决方案、哈希现金机制与账户备份六个维度,系统探讨能量的定义、管理和最佳实践。
1) 能量的概念与度量
能量通常对应于链上执行资源(类似于“Gas”),用于衡量交易与合约调用的计算与存储消耗。在 TPWallet 中,能量既可由原生代币抵扣,也可以通过预付、抵押或二层计量机制补充。关键指标包括:能量余额、能量价格(动态浮动)、单位操作消耗、能量峰值与延迟。
2) 便捷资产存取
- 自动化充值/回收:支持按策略自动将用户代币兑换为能量或从能量回收为代币,减少手动操作。可集成预言机获取实时价格,避免滑点。
- 多通道入金/出金:支持链上直存、跨链桥、法币通道与闪兑,结合冷热钱包分层管理,保障流动性与安全。
- 用户体验:在 UI 上隐藏能量概念,提供“一键支付/一键授权”体验,同时在高级设置中提供能量详情与策略选择。
3) 合约开发与能量优化
- 费用建模:开发者应将能量消耗纳入合约设计早期,采用按需加载、紧凑数据结构与事件替代冗余存储等手段降低消耗。
- 模块化与复用:通过库合约、代理合约与合约抽象减少重复字节码与部署成本,从而节约能量。
- 测试与模拟:在本地与测试网使用能量消耗剖析工具(profiler)与回放工具进行基准测试,建立 CI 流水线中的成本回归检测。
- 安全性:能量受限场景下需防止重入、资源枯竭和拒绝服务,采用限流、熔断与分段执行策略。
4) 专业视角报告(运营与审计)
- 风险评估:量化能量枯竭风险、费用波动风险与外部依赖(如预言机)失效的影响。
- 指标监控:建议监控 TPS、平均能量消耗、峰值交易消耗、未成功交易率与能量失败原因分布。
- 审计与合规:对合约进行费用模型审计、异常消耗检测与合规审查(税务与反洗钱场景)。
- 报告输出:面向产品团队的运营仪表盘、面向审计方的可复现能量消耗链路、面向管理层的成本与收益分析。
5) 智能化支付解决方案
- 路由与聚合:集成跨通道路由器自动选择最优能量/费用路径(链上直付、闪兑、代付/Relayer),实现最优成本与体验。
- 订阅与定时支付:对能量进行周期性充值、预扣,支持订阅型服务与分期扣费。
- 元交易与代付:利用中继(relayer)与元交易机制,允许账户无需直接持有能量即可完成操作,钱包或服务提供商代为支付并在后续结算。


- 微支付与分片结算:针对小额高频场景,采用支付通道或状态通道,极大降低能量消耗与链上手续费。
6) 哈希现金(Hashcash)在 TPWallet 的应用
- 抗垃圾与费率调节:Hashcash 可作为轻量级 PoW 机制,用于限制高频空交易或防止垃圾请求,作为能量不足时的付费替代或优先级证明。
- 证明与优先级:交易可携带 Hashcash 证明以提升包含概率,结合动态能量价格形成混合定价策略。
- 成本与公平性:需平衡算力消耗与能量成本,避免将经济负担转嫁给资源受限用户。Hashcash 更适合临时防护或门槛控制,而非长期主费率方案。
7) 账户备份与能量恢复策略
- 助记词与私钥:标准化助记词备份、分段加密备份与多地点冷存储;明示助记词恢复后需做能量补充的流程提示。
- 多签与社会恢复:通过多签钱包或社会恢复机制降低单点失窃风险,并允许受托方在特定条件下为用户恢复能量或执行紧急操作。
- 加密备份与策略恢复:支持对能量相关策略(自动充值规则、白名单 relayer)一并备份,恢复后自动恢复充值管道与支付授权。
- 硬件与协议集成:建议与硬件钱包、托管服务和链上身份系统集成,提供分层恢复流程与权限最小化原则。
结语:TPWallet 中的“能量”既是技术资源,也是用户体验与商业设计的枢纽。通过合理的能量经济模型、合约与客户端的联合优化、智能支付路由与稳健的备份机制,可在保障安全的同时实现便捷、低成本与可扩展的链上服务。专业报告与监控体系则保证运维与合规的可视化与可控性。最终,能量管理的目标是让普通用户“感觉不到能量的存在”,而开发者和运营者则能通过工具与策略有效控制成本与风险。
评论
小灰
对能量与元交易的结合讲得很清晰,尤其是用户体验层面的建议,实用。
TechSam
关于 Hashcash 的定位分析到位,认为它更适合做临时防护而非长期费率补充,赞同。
链上观察者
建议补充一些具体的监控指标阈值和告警策略,便于快速落地运营。
Lina
多签与社会恢复的部分写得很好,能量恢复流程提示尤其重要,避免用户因能量不足丧失资产控制权。
Anton
合约优化部分希望能给出更具体的代码示例或工具链推荐,方便开发者实践。